How to define a Registered Agent?

A designated agent is an person or business designated to receive official papers on behalf of a business entity. This includes key paperwork such as legal notifications, official correspondence, and regulatory notices. Each company, whether an Limited Liability Company or corporate entity, is mandated to have a registered agent to ensure they can be reached for official matters.

The primary responsibility of a registered agent is to maintain a registered office during standard operating hours, where legal documents can be received. This position is vital for ensuring that a company does not fail to receive important legal notices, which can lead to severe repercussions, including financial sanctions or loss of corporate status. Hiring a dependable registered agent can provide assurance, knowing that these essential documents are taken care of correctly.

Designated agents can be individuals or professional registered agent services that focus in this capacity. Using a business registered agent service often comes with added benefits such as compliance monitoring, which helps monitor key submission dates and compliance rules. Choosing the appropriate statutory agent is crucial for firms looking to protect their rights and stay compliant with state laws.

A registered agent plays a crucial role in the operation of a business entity. A major responsibility includes being the official contact between the business and state authorities. This involves receiving vital legal documents such as service of process, tax notices, and notices related to compliance. By performing this function, a registered agent makes sure that the business is aware of its legal commitments and can address problems as they come up.

Apart from receiving legal documents, the registered agent is tasked with upholding compliance with state regulations. This requires tracking deadlines for necessary filings, renewals, and other legal obligations that a business ought to fulfill to stay in good standing. Non-compliance with these requirements may result in penalties such as fines or loss of good standing, emphasizing the critical role of a dependable registered agent for any business.

Furthermore, the registered agent must offer a physical location in the state of incorporation, usually termed the registered office. This address is where legal documents are served and must be accessible during normal business hours. Engaging a professional registered agent provides reassurance, as it ensures there is a committed person or service managing these responsibilities, allowing the business to concentrate on operations without worrying about missing vital legal communications.

Conformity with lawful requirements is crucial for businesses to preserve their good standing and safeguard their interests. Each state mandates that corporations and limited liability companies appoint a designated agent who is responsible for receiving important legal documents on behalf of the business. This obligation ensures that the business can be readily reached for legal notifications, ensuring that they are informed about any lawsuits or official communications. Failure to maintain a designated agent can result in penalties, including the potential loss of good standing and the difficulty to operate business legally within the jurisdiction.

Understanding the responsibilities of a designated agent is crucial for company owners. The registered agent must be on call during regular operating hours to receive documents such as financial notices, lawful summons, and additional official correspondence. It is also the designated agent's responsibility to send these documents to the company owner in a timely manner. By contracting a qualified registered agent provider, companies can guarantee conformity with these legal requirements and minimize the chance of missing critical communications.
